Brick Tuckpointing Service in Cleveland, OH
Brick tuckpointing services involve the careful removal and replacement of deteriorated mortar between bricks to restore the structural integrity and appearance of masonry walls. This process is commonly requested for projects such as repairing damaged brick facades, restoring historic buildings, or maintaining the exterior of residential properties. Homeowners typically want to understand the extent of mortar deterioration, the types of mortar suitable for their brickwork, and how tuckpointing can help prevent further damage caused by moisture or weather exposure.
Before requesting brick tuckpointing, property owners should assess the condition of their brickwork and identify visible signs of mortar deterioration, such as crumbling, cracking, or missing mortar joints. It’s also helpful to consider the age of the building and the materials used in the original construction. Proper preparation and matching mortar colors are important for achieving a seamless appearance, and understanding the scope of work can assist in planning maintenance or restoration projects that enhance both the durability and aesthetic appeal of the property.

Brick Tuckpointing Service Questions
What is brick tuckpointing? Brick tuckpointing involves removing damaged mortar and replacing it to restore the appearance and stability of brickwork.
When should brick tuckpointing be considered? Tuckpointing is recommended when mortar joints show signs of cracking, crumbling, or deterioration.
Can tuckpointing improve the appearance of brickwork? Yes, it can enhance curb appeal by making brick surfaces look fresh and well-maintained.
What types of projects typically require tuckpointing services? Tuckpointing is commonly used for restoring chimneys, walls, foundations, and decorative brick features.
